Output 3837dccd6c6b3d8da7694330e6675638290199539791b99b802f098f3ed7987a:1

value
2500786
script pubkey
OP_0 OP_PUSHBYTES_20 5565cb413536722e94dbe086d14dbd7c87bacb2a
address
bc1q24juksf4xeeza9xmuzrdznda0jrm4je2rrj0y7
transaction
3837dccd6c6b3d8da7694330e6675638290199539791b99b802f098f3ed7987a
confirmations
44957
spent
true